Subject: bug#39143: 26.3; `widget-complete' in `customize-option'

> emacs -Q
> 
> `M-x customize-option default-frame-alist'
> 
> Click `INS'.
> 
> Enter `cursor-color' for field `Parameter: '.
> 
> Put cursor at beginning of field `Value: ', and delete the default
> value, `nil'.
> 
> Use `M-TAB' (or `ESC TAB').
> 
> You get this error/message: "Not in an editable field".

In Emacs 27 get the message "No completions available for this field"
instead.  So this problem is already solved.

> 1. That message is incorrect.  The cursor is definitely in an editable
> field.  (Same incorrect message if you first type `Blu', then `M-TAB'.)

This part is already solved.

> 2. Emacs should provide reasonable completion for both fields,
> `Parameter' and `Value', for `default-frame-alist'.

It does provide completions for Parameter, although it's debatable
whether they are "reasonable".
